Journey of the soul

The following is the journey of the "privledged soul" after death as described by Yogi Bhajan. 
 
"You must understand that the privileged soul has certain privileges. When the journey begins, the soul leaves the subtle body. The first privilege of the "privledged soul" is to say good-bye to all friends and foes equally. Next the soul travels to all places of reverence - those places which were sacred to its the "last journey". You might have heard about this concept, but maybe you have never really understood it. I am  trying to make you understand it now; the soul visits every place of reverence.

The next privilege is to visit all the places of the altar-the the Guru's places. A privileged soul has very exalted manners and a responsibility to say a graceful good-bye before returning home. That is why when a person leaves and the relatives perform kirtan, they use lofty bandages and praise the Lord during this scared period of mourning. Some people perform this ritual for seventeen days, and some only do this for three or four days. As you know, the modern world doesn't deal with death very well. But the soul is very anti-modern; does its job.

After visiting all the altars, the soul has the privilege to travel in the company of the angelic world. The privileged soul does not go through the normal  human path. It doesn't pass through the test of triumph and trials.

After finishing its duties on earth, the soul travels to the angelic world. In this world, the soul is filled with  brightness, lightness, humor and glow. It also practices forgiveness for the whole universe, through which it has traveled for many lifetimes.

You must understand that the privledged soul has to enter the akal abode; Infinity. The angelic world is defined by all good, wonders and happiness.

After enjoying the privilege of the angelic world, the soul travels into the third blue ether which is its own great abode of prayer. In its purity and piety, it settles its own account. Thereafter it crosses into the fourth blue ether. Chauthe par, the fourth step, is to find infinite salvation.

Therefore, if you join at this time in this journey, it will guarantee your journey in the future."
